It's a bitmask, and if you want to > check multiple states, then we should just do so with > > if (t->state & (TASK_xxx | TASK_yyy | ...)) > > Oh, well. The inequality comparisons are shorter, and historical, so I > guess it's debatable whether we should remove them all. I did a quick grep through 2.6.14-rc2 to see how many "them all" were, and the only two places I could find, where a inequality operator was being used on a task state, were this one in kernel/signal.c and another in kernel/exit.c: ./kernel/exit.c:1194: unlikely(p->state > TASK_STOPPED) So maybe it is not so bad to just change these to a bit mask and disallow inequality comparisons in the future, if you guys feel that is the way to go... -- Paulo Marques - www.grupopie.com The rule is perfect: in all matters of opinion our adversaries are insane.
